“Televising the U.K. Series here in the USA is the first step toward developing the U.S. series to be of similar stature and success,” said Phil Wicks. “I think that many MINI fans will discover the tremendous excitement and competitive nature of the MINI Challenge in the U.K. and will want to join in our racing series being developed for the American market. We’re very excited that we have made these arrangements to televise the U.K. MINI Challenge Series.” The racing will debut on the newly launched MavTV network. MavTV is a new network that carries a variety of programming themes targeting men 18-49, including sports, sports analysis, gaming, comedy, women and relationships, health and fitness, finance, gadgets, and movies. MavTV is a 24/7 destination channel dedicated to reaching men in an irreverent, humorous, opinionated fashion. Now MINI racing joins the mix of programming that is carried by the network. Times and broadcast schedules will be announced soon. MINI enthusiasts that don’t receive MavTV on their cable system are encouraged to call their local cable provider and ask for it. For additional information on MavTV visit their website at www.mavtv.com. “The quality of the racing TV coverage is superb,” added Mackey Marketing president, Brian Mackey. “This series makes great television viewing and I think the American audiences will love the action and the competitive nature of this series. I want to thank the MavTV network for believing in our product and providing this opportunity. We look forward to a great relationship with MavTV.” Phil Wicks owns and operates the Phil Wicks MINI Driving Academy as well as administering the North American MINI Cooper Championship racing series.
